Alguns estilos de fontes instaladas estão ausentes ou "sobrepostos"

Alguns estilos de fontes instaladas estão ausentes ou "sobrepostos"

Recentemente comprei um conjunto completo de Futura para um projeto de design de classe, principalmente para obter uma variedade de pesos e estilos diferentes (o projeto é baseado em tipografia). Recebi as fontes como um conjunto de 21 arquivos TTF, mas quando tento instalá-las no Windows 7 Ultimate de 64 bits, apenas 6 ou 7 estilos aparecem no Illustrator ou Word quando tento usar a fonte.

Encontrei isto (abaixo) que parece ser o mesmo problema, mas não há nenhuma evidência de solução aqui e realmente não tenho a opção de desistir da fonte - a tarefa nos deu um pequeno número de fontes para escolher , e Futura é de longe a opção mais interessante.

http://answers.microsoft.com/en-us/windows/forum/windows_7-desktop/some-styles-of-installed-fonts-are-missing-or/f9ae2de9-5f84-4ed7-8198-c9282ea68aea?tm= 1315399626275

Alguém mais encontrou esse problema e encontrou uma solução alternativa? (Ou, na falta disso, alguém sabe onde posso conseguir um software que me permita editar o nome do tipo de letra para que os diferentes estilos não se agrupem?)

Responder1

FontForgepode ser de alguma ajuda na renomeação das famílias de fontes.

Responder2

FontForge realmente resolve esse problema. Serei mais gentil, entretanto, e direi COMO resolver o problema usando FontForge.

Links relevantes:

Página de download do FontForge

Fonte Hickory Jack(com uma versão Regular e Light)

Baixe e instale FontForge (gratuito). Crie uma pasta para a fonte Hickory Jack. Baixe a fonte Hickory Jack (vem em um ZIP). Extraia os dois arquivos para a pasta que você criou.

Hickory Jack é uma fonte gratuita que exibe o comportamento listado - ou seja, que a instalação de dois arquivos de fonte resulta em uma fonte listada no Windows. Excluir a fonte listada (que é sempre o arquivo de fonte instalado por último) revela a outra fonte restante.

Abra as fontes

Inicie o FontForge. Navegue até a pasta com as fontes e escolha o arquivo de fonte chamado “Hickory Jack.ttf”.

Agora repita estas instruções para abrir o arquivo chamado “Hickory Jack Light.ttf”. Agora você tem duas cópias do FontForge em execução.

Para facilitar para você, mova e dimensione as janelas de modo que a janela “Hickory Jack” fique no lado esquerdo da tela e a janela “Hickory Jack Light” fique no lado direito.

Editar metadados de fonte inválidos/ausentes

Para cada instância, escolha ELEMENT * FONT INFO (ou CTRL-SHIFT-F). Isso abre oInformações da fontejanela. Essas janelas aparecem no centro da tela, portanto você deve movê-las para a esquerda ou para a direita.

EscolherNomes PSopção na borda esquerda.
Mudar oPesovalores para cada fonte (inicialmente são idênticos):

  • Hickory Jack: Altere “Livro” para “Regular”
  • Hickory Jack Light: Mude “Livro” para “Light”

EscolherSO/2opção na borda esquerda.
Mudar oClasse de pesovalores para Hickory Jack Light:

  • Hickory Jack: Deveria ser “400 Regular”
  • Hickory Jack Light: mudança de “400 Regular” para “300 Light”

EscolherNomes de TTFopção na borda esquerda.
Compare as duas fontes. Esta informação está correta. Você pode ver que também pode alterar as informações do texto aqui. O mais importante: duas fontes não devem ter a mesmaID únicovalor.

Clique em OK em ambas as janelas de informações da fonte. Você corrigiu os metadados com sucesso.

Regenerar os arquivos de fonte

As fontes originais são fontes True Type (TTF). Iremos salvá-los como fontes Open Type (OTF).

Para a fonte Hickory Jack, escolha FILE * GENERATE FONTS (ou digite CTRL-SHIFT-G). Isto mostra oGerar fontesjanela.

Escolha OpenType (CFF) na lista suspensa para que as alterações de fonte sejam salvas como arquivos OTF. Ele sugere um nome de arquivo (HickoryJack.otf), mas você deve alterá-lo paraHickoryJack-Regular.otf. CliqueGerar. Uma janela aparece intitulada "Erros detectados". Estes não são realmente erros, então ignore-os e clique no botãoGerarbotão.

Para a fonte Hickory Jack Light, escolha FILE * GENERATE FONTS (ou digite CTRL-SHIFT-G).

Ele sugere um nome de arquivo (HickoryJack-Light.otf) que é perfeito. CliqueGerar. Uma janela aparece intitulada "Erros detectados". Novamente, ignore esta mensagem e clique no botãoGerarbotão.

Mova ou exclua os arquivos de fontes antigos e inválidos

Agora você deve ter quatro arquivos na pasta de fontes que criou:

  • Hickory Jack Light.ttf
  • Hickory Jack.ttf
  • HickoryJack-Regular.otf
  • HickoryJack-Light.otf

Você pode excluir os arquivos TTF. Você também pode instalar os arquivos de fonte OTF e notará imediatamente que o Windows agora os agrupa corretamente (chamado Agrupamento Familiar).

Por que isso funcionou?

Às vezes, as fontes possuem metadados incorretos. Você viu quantas opções existem, então não é exatamente difícil ver como erros podem ser cometidos.

Neste caso, o Windows parecia ver as duas fontes como idênticas, já que oClasse de Peso OS/2os valores eram os mesmos. Para o Windows, ambas as fontes estavam no mesmofamília(Hickory Jack) e teve o mesmopeso(Regular), tornando-os essencialmente a mesma fonte. Portanto não foi necessário carregar ou expor a segunda fonte aos aplicativos.

No Windows, as fontes com o mesmo nome de família são agrupadas. As fontes agrupadas podem interferir umas nas outras se tiverem o mesmo peso.

Então agora você sabe como resolver DOIS problemas:

  • Se você instalar diversas fontes que deveriam ser agrupadas como uma Família, mas elas aparecerem como fontes individuais com nomes semelhantes, você poderá forçá-las a se agruparem definindo suasNomes PS:Nome de famíliavalores sejam iguais.
  • Se várias fontes da mesma família estiverem instaladas, mas nem todas aparecerem nas Fontes do Windows, talvez seja necessário alterar oOS/2:Classe de pesovalores para as fontes para que o Windows as veja como fontes diferentes.

informação relacionada